In this episode of 'How it Happens with Colin Cook', Colin takes a deep dive into Romans 6:9 and the profound concept that the dominion of sin and death is over. He passionately explains how faith in the Gospel of Christ can intercept various forms of addiction, whether it's alcohol, drugs, food, or obsessive worry. Colin shares his personal reflections on the Book of Romans, highlighting its ever-expanding depth and beauty.
He discusses how Christ's resurrection signifies that death no longer has dominion over Him, and by extension, over us who believe in Him. This episode is filled with inspiring insights about our identity with Jesus and the freedom from sin's power and condemnation.
